Mexi-Mac Skillet Recipe

Recipe By Slurrp

Mexi-Mac Skillet is a delicious and easy one-pot meal that combines the flavors of Mexican cuisine with classic macaroni and cheese. This hearty dish features ground beef, bell peppers, onions, and corn, all cooked together in a skillet with spices like cumin and chili powder. The macaroni is then added along with a creamy cheese sauce, creating a comforting and flavorful meal that the whole family will love.
